Pipe Unclogging in Denver, CO
Pipe unclogging services involve clearing blockages from residential plumbing systems to restore proper flow and prevent water damage. This service typically covers projects such as clogged kitchen sinks, bathroom drains, toilets, and main sewer lines. Property owners often seek this service when experiencing slow-draining fixtures, foul odors, or backups that disrupt daily routines. Understanding the location of the clog, the type of blockage, and the potential causes can help homeowners communicate effectively with service providers and ensure the most appropriate solution is applied.
Before requesting pipe unclogging services, property owners should consider whether the clog is isolated or part of a broader plumbing issue. It’s helpful to identify any recent changes in plumbing performance, such as recurring backups or multiple drains affected simultaneously. Additionally, knowing the age of the plumbing system and any previous repairs can assist in diagnosing the problem. Clear information about the affected fixtures and the severity of the clog can facilitate a quicker, more efficient resolution.

Common Pipe Unclogging Jobs
Drain clearing - removing blockages to restore proper water flow in household pipes.
Kitchen drain unclogging - resolving stubborn clogs in sinks and garbage disposals.
Bathroom pipe cleaning - clearing hair, soap scum, and debris from bathroom drains.
Main sewer line service - addressing severe clogs affecting the entire plumbing system.
Pipe snaking - using specialized tools to break up and remove obstructions.
Hydro jetting - employing high-pressure water to thoroughly clean pipes and prevent future clogs.
Pipe Unclogging Questions
What causes pipe clogs? Common causes include hair, grease, food particles, and mineral buildup that accumulate over time.
How can I tell if a pipe is clogged? Signs include slow draining sinks, gurgling sounds, or water backing up in fixtures.
Are chemical drain cleaners effective? Chemical cleaners may provide temporary relief but can damage pipes and often do not resolve stubborn clogs.
What should property owners do before a professional arrives? Avoid using excessive force or chemicals and keep the area accessible for inspection and service.
